Xcode IPad应用程序必须是crashsafe

Xcode IPad应用程序必须是crashsafe,xcode,ipad,crash,Xcode,Ipad,Crash,我正在开发一款IPad应用程序,它必须是不可擦除的,因为所有应用程序的主屏幕都不能出现。主页按钮被一个盒子盖住了。为什么我需要这个?这个应用程序将在一些公共场所用于推广和反馈 如果主屏幕出现,每个人都可以随心所欲地使用IPad。它已经尽可能地受到IPhone配置工具的限制可悲的是,应用程序内部需要互联网连接,因为有一个内部网络浏览器可以访问预选页面,但这对我来说还不够 有没有一种方法可以执行以下一项或多项操作以使该应用程序保持在前台 应用程序通过自我重置和自我控制来实现内部错误处理,类似的事情在

我正在开发一款IPad应用程序,它必须是不可擦除的,因为所有应用程序的主屏幕都不能出现。主页按钮被一个盒子盖住了。为什么我需要这个?这个应用程序将在一些公共场所用于推广和反馈

如果主屏幕出现,每个人都可以随心所欲地使用IPad。它已经尽可能地受到IPhone配置工具的限制可悲的是,应用程序内部需要互联网连接,因为有一个内部网络浏览器可以访问预选页面,但这对我来说还不够

有没有一种方法可以执行以下一项或多项操作以使该应用程序保持在前台

应用程序通过自我重置和自我控制来实现内部错误处理,类似的事情在Windows中是可能的。这是我最喜欢的决议。有这样的API吗? 应用程序崩溃,或者用户通过磁铁、发送器或类似的方式退出/最小化应用程序,应用程序会自动重新启动 应用程序崩溃,但主屏幕内的任何内容都无法由每个人启动 应用程序在崩溃后冻结并发出警报,直到工作人员重新启动 该应用程序在后台被另一个应用程序监视,如果关闭或最小化,则通过向其发送电话、短信、消息等向工作人员发出警报。 另一项类似的决议 它不需要遵守Appstore规则,因为它不会部署它。只是内部使用。如果只有脏代码来做这件事,总比没有好

工作人员可以按下home(主页)按钮,因为它可以稍后打开箱子


电池电量不会耗尽,因为它一直由powersocket适配器供电。

这可能会有所帮助。是的,您正在寻找商店演示模式。顺便说一句,如果你的应用程序崩溃,它将由操作系统重新启动,而不会返回到主屏幕。@rokjarc我相信我们不应该通过其他人提供的解决方案获得声誉。我只是将OP指向正确的链接:不,它只是禁用home按钮,并且不会阻止应用程序崩溃后返回主屏幕-